3-time Oscar winner Meryl Streep to receive Palm Springs Fest Icon Award

The Palm Springs International Film Festival said that the 17-time Oscar nominee and three-time winner Meryl Streep has been tapped for its Icon Award, which “honors a creative talent who, through the course of his or her career, has created a body of work which symbolizes the highest level of achievement in the motion picture art form,” Deadline said.

Streep is on the awards radar again this year for her role as the matriarch of a Midwestern family in August: Osage County, director John Wells’ adaptation of the Pulitzer-winning play by Tracy Letts. The 25th edition of PSIFF runs January 3-13 in the desert city.
